Description




3M Sun Control Window Films are advanced films applied to glass for homes, buildings, and cars, designed to block heat, reduce glare, and cut harmful UV rays while letting in visible light, using nano-technology for clarity and durability, improving comfort, saving energy, and protecting interiors from fading. Key benefits include significant solar heat rejection (up to 97% infrared), UV blocking (up to 99.9%), glare reduction, enhanced insulation, and long-lasting performance with scratch resistance and strong warranties.
Key Features & Benefits:
Heat Rejection: Blocks a significant portion of solar heat (visible light and infrared) to keep interiors cooler.
UV Protection: Rejects up to 99.9% of UV rays, preventing fading of furniture, carpets, and car interiors.
Glare Reduction: Significantly reduces harsh glare, improving visibility and comfort, even at night in some series.
Clarity & Appearance: Many films, like the Prestige and Crystalline series, are nearly clear, using nano-technology for high performance without darkening the glass too much.
Energy Savings: Reduces reliance on air conditioning, lowering energy costs.
Durability: Features a scratch-resistant coating for clear views and long life, with strong warranties.
Signal Friendly: Non-metallized options (like Crystalline) don’t interfere with GPS, satellite radio, or mobile devices.
Common Series Examples:
Prestige Series: Clear, spectrally selective films using nano-technology to reject high heat and UV.
Crystalline Series: Offers the highest heat rejection with lighter tints, using multi-layer optical film.
Night Vision Series: Low interior reflectivity for better nighttime views while still controlling heat and glare.
Ceramic Series: Uses advanced nano-ceramics for heat rejection and color stability.
Applications:
Architectural: Residential and commercial buildings for comfort and energy efficiency.
Automotive: Cars for comfort, UV protection, and glare reduction, even on windshields.
